1 Hurt in Fort Worth Accidental Shooting: Police

One person has been transported to an area hospital after an apparent accidental shooting Thursday afternoon in Tarrant County.

Fort Worth police and Med Star emergency crews were called at about 5:30 p.m. to the 2300 block of Northeast 37th Street.

Police said two young adults were handling a gun when one of them accidentally fired the weapon, resulting in one being injured.

The injuries do not appear to be significant, police said.

Further details have not been released, and the shooting remains under investigation.
